Transaction f641b8cedb88cfc0bf698133aaf6b7b21742d69e93cec77f9bb102c874e24157
2 Input
2 Outputs
- f641b8cedb88cfc0bf698133aaf6b7b21742d69e93cec77f9bb102c874e24157:0
- f641b8cedb88cfc0bf698133aaf6b7b21742d69e93cec77f9bb102c874e24157:1
value 3875766
address 12Svyg5mSGL3RkoiSU2znTzvNFdvpoqqpq
value 5000000
address 31jPFaNYfD5Pex3SfeBxCJKa5RS276ntgR